Frequently Asked Questions
Q: What constitutes a wrongful death case in West Palm Beach?A: A wrongful death case in West Palm Beach typically arises when someone's negligent or intentional actions result in the death of another person. This can include car accidents, medical malpractice, workplace accidents, defective products, or other incidents where liability clearly exists.
Q: How long do I have to file a wrongful death claim in Florida?A: In Florida, the statute of limitations for filing a wrongful death claim is generally two years from the date of the deceased person's death. It is crucial to consult with an attorney promptly to ensure your claim is filed within this time frame.

Q: What types of compensation can be sought in a West Palm Beach wrongful death lawsuit?A: Potential compensation includes medical expenses, funeral and burial costs, lost income, loss of companionship and support, and in cases involving significant negligence or malice, punitive damages.
